省管干部综合管理系统数据集成交换平台
2012-04-29吴红刚鲁绍坤徐玲
吴红刚 鲁绍坤 徐玲
[摘要] 信息技术已成为组织人事工作不可缺少的工作手段。为进一步提高工作效率,我们以云南省委组织部干部综合管理系统为核心,构建了一个涵盖省编制办公室、省人力资源与社会保障厅、省财政厅的数据集成交换平台。
[关键词] 干部管理;中间件;数据交换
doi : 10 . 3969 / j . issn . 1673 - 0194 . 2012 . 20. 042
[中图分类号]TP311[文献标识码]A[文章编号]1673 - 0194(2012)20- 0071- 02
1概述
当前,信息化对党的建设和组织工作在思想、观念、内容和方法等各个方面都产生了广泛而深远的影响,在服务党的建设和组织人事工作中也发挥着越来越重要的作用。组织系统信息化工作是国家信息化工作的重要组成部分,信息化工作已经成为新形势下组织部门一项重要的基础性工作,信息技术已成为组织人事工作不可缺少的工作手段。
与组织人事工作有关的四大部门:云南省委组织部、省编办、省人事厅、省财政厅都按照自己的工作流程精心构建了自己的一套管理系统。但由于各自工作的侧重点不同和数据尚未实现共享,往往一次人事变动要在四大部门之间来回办理。例如工资审批工作,要经过编办年初核定人数,接着到人事厅规划信息处、工资福利处或省委组织部干部一处审核,再到财政厅国库处报送工资信息数据,最后才到拨款这样一系的列环节,而且一有人员变动,该工作又要再循环一遍。4个部门工作效率再高,也无法让各办事部门实现高效准确。
另外,几年前网络上炒作比较厉害的铁岭市有9位副市长20位副秘书长,河南新乡有11个副市长等系列事件,极大地损害了组织部门的管理的形象。这些事件的出现有各方面的原因,其中我们也应该可以看到,当地的组织部门、人事部门和编办的信息没有实现跨部门互通,信息成为了孤岛。
在本方案中,我们计划通过信息技术实现信息数据的采集和规范整合,建立各类干部信息库、编制信息库,实现组织人事涵盖任免、培训、考核、监督、奖惩、工资、出国、档案、离退休、调动、死亡等信息管理。从而实现全省省级政府各工作部门、省高级人民法院、省检察院及其干部任用、机构设置、人员编制、财政拨款等管理一体化、科学化,最终实现办事的高效和准确。同时也实现省委组织部、省编办、省人事厅、省财政厅跨部门数据互联互通,打破部门间的信息孤岛。
2目标和内容
由于各部门原都建有自己的管理平台,而且各个平台在不同的部门中已经运行多年,能有效应对本部门工作中的各类问题。由于大家对自己的系统操作已经比较娴熟,我们不需要重新搭建一套系统去让大家适应,计划在各部门原有系统的基础上,搭建一个数据交换平台,辅之以有效的加密传输技术,确保数据的安全交换,最终实现一个科学管理、一体化应用的基础平台。
计划建设的数据交换平台,实现省委组织部、省编办、省人事厅、省财政厅跨部门数据互联互通,打破部门间的信息孤岛,建立基础数据库,包括干部库、中管干部库、后备干部库、县长书记库、四大班子委员库及自定义干部库。促进部门协作高效性,数据一致性。
3需求分析
3.1业务需求
按照我省干部管理的有关要求,根据干部任免和录用程序,实现组织部、编办、人事、财政一体化管理。解决跨部门的数据采集、数据比对、数据汇总、数据下发,实现四部门之间的数据安全可靠共享与交换。
3.2功能需求
数据交换系统从技术上主要是实现数据抽取、数据可靠传输、流量控制、断点续传、队列保障等;通过应用集成管理实现不同数据格式之间转换、数据加工、交换流程定义、交换策略选择等。同时要保障参与数据交换的信息点是真实有效的合法用户,传输的数据不被非法用户截取等。
从应用上主要是实现数据在多个部门之间的可靠传输和数据转换。同时保证系统的接入点的可扩张性。
4系统部署方案
4.1数据交换系统体系结构
根据应用规模及应用内容,所选择技术体系结构时最重要的是考虑整个系统的跨系统性、安全性、可靠性、稳定性及可管理性,同时技术体系结构应该有非常好的可扩展能力。
系统总体体系结构如图1。
以组织部为交换中心,建立中心—前置模式,统一规范的前置交换机制不但是解决当前数据交换的首要前提,也是跨部门之间业务协作的基础保障,同时为各部门之间的数据交互与业务协作长远发展奠定基础。
业务管理:组织部、编办、人事厅、财政厅日常使用的干部信息管理系统,产生和管理日常的干部基础数据。
共享及交换库:从各部门共享出来的干部基础数据。包括供其他部门共享使用的和从其他部门反馈回来的信息。作为数据跨部门的出口和入口。
数据采集及同步:从各部门信息共享库采集数据,并实时获取干部基础数据的插入、更新、删除变化数据。
数据安全可靠保障:将数据传输到组织部,实现网络上的数据安全可靠的传输保障机制。
数据写入及同步:将从各部门共享交换来的数据实时写入干部管理应用系统数据库。
系统集成产品选型:
东方通应用集成中间件TongIntegrator;
东方通消息中间件TongLink/Q;
密钥。
4.2总体部署(见图2)
数据交换系统由应用集成中间件TongIntegrator和消息传输中间件TongLink/Q组成。
在各部门共享端部署应用集成中间件TongIntegrator Adaptor和消息中间件TongLink/Q;提供数据采集、数据同步、数据转换、数据过滤、数据压缩、数据加密等功能;
在组织部部署应用集成中间件TongIntegrator和消息中间件TongLink/Q;提供数据采集与同步、数据转换、数据过滤、数据解密、数据解压、数据加工清洗、例外处理、应用搭建部署、系统管理、系统日志、监控统计等功能;
通过TongIntegrator和TongLink/Q搭建的数据交换系统实现多部门数据的交换、同步,用XML作为数据交换的中间格式,同时系统提供多种映射转换。
5技术总结
采用中间件技术构建的数据交换系统减少了系统结构的复杂程度,选用国产主流中间件技术,也增强了系统的可扩张性、稳定性、安全性等。在实际的应用过程中数据的发布过程和接收过程均采用事件触发方式,保证信息的实时性;通过消息中间件、适配器建立多个系统之间是一种松耦合的关系,保证出现故障时候只影响某一点的数据不能实时获得,同时也保证了系统的灵活可扩张性;适配器提供了一个有效减少编程代价即可进行集成的方法,通过适配器这种插件式的方式即插即工作,使整个系统具有极高的可扩展性,同时也使系统的升级变得极为简便等特性。同时通过密钥管理,可以及时根据技术的进一步完善,不断提升信息的安全性和保密性。
主要参考文献
[1] 张之珺. 基于重构的轻量级SOA架构[D]. 上海:华东师范大学,2008.
[2] 李毅. 基于SOA的设备状态监测与故障诊断系统的研究[D]. 上海:上海交通大学, 2008.
[3] 张峰. 面向服务架构的服务总线的设计与实现[D]. 沈阳:中国科学院研究生院(沈阳计算技术研究所), 2008.
[4] 刘迎春,兰雨晴,于乐乐. ESB中的数据交换技术[J]. 计算机系统应用,2005(10).